Mental Workload Estimation with Electroencephalogram Signals by Combining Multi-Space Deep Models
March 13, 2024, 4:44 a.m. | Hong-Hai Nguyen, Ngumimi Karen Iyortsuun, Seungwon Kim, Hyung-Jeong Yang, Soo-Hyung Kim
cs.LG upd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
Abstract: The human brain remains continuously active, whether an individual is working or at rest. Mental activity is a daily process, and if the brain becomes excessively active, known as overload, it can adversely affect human health. Recently, advancements in early prediction of mental health conditions have emerged, aiming to prevent serious consequences and enhance the overall quality of life.
